Provisional Patent Applications In order to receive a patent based on the subject matter disclosed in a provisional patent application, a non-provisional patent application must be filed within one year of the filing of the provisional application and make a claim of priority to the provisional application.
This can help to delay the bulk of costs when patenting your invention. The provisional application enables you to obtain quickly an official filing date before the public disclosure of the invention. It serves as undisputed proof of the invention date at least as early as the provisional filing date.
Provisional applications offer cost-effective and flexible early protection, allowing inventors to establish a priority date and refine their invention over a 12-month period. Complete applications, on the other hand, provide comprehensive legal protection and are essential for enforcing patent rights.
A provisional patent application is not an actual patent. A provisional patent application is a cheap and fast way to gain protection on an invention for 12 months and allows the inventor to test and perfect a concept prior to filing a full patent.

The provisional patent application cover sheet is a form that you file with the specification and drawings of your patent application. It's a request (see snippet below) for filing your application as a provisional application.
We recommend filing an ADS or application data sheet in any provisional or nonprovisional application to ensure that the Patent Office has the data that it needs and in the form that it wants the data to reduce errors.
